Foreach Loop Container

The Foreach Loop container defines a repeating control flow in a package. The loop implementation is similar to Foreach looping structure in programming languages. In a package, looping is enabled by using a Foreach enumerator. The Foreach Loop container repeats the control flow for each member of a specified enumerator. Script Task

The Script task provides code to perform functions that are not available in the built-in tasks and transformations that SQL Server Integration Services provides. File System Task

The File System task performs operations on files and directories in the file system. For example, by using the File System task, a package can create, move, or delete directories and files. Sequence Container

The Sequence container defines a control flow that is a subset of the package control flow. Sequence containers group the package into multiple separate control flows, each containing one or more tasks and containers that run within the overall package control flow.
